Padawan since a very young age and has never known his parents. He was recognized as a force-user and was taken before he had any memories. His parents are probably alive somewhere on a fringe world and Jaicen would like to meet them one time. During a training excercise on a jedi temple Jaicen was horribly injured by another Initiate who failed around. His nervous system got horribly wrecked beyond repair and he is confined to a hovering wheelchair. He still has a strong force connection and since lightsaber combat and other physical skills were out of the question Jaicen focused more on droid programming. Using the force to connect and directly control them. Skills A Jedi Knight on a remote Jedi Temple taught him, after he took pity on Jaicen during a visit and took him under his wing. The Knight also provided Jaicen with the DEM crystal, needed to control his droid. After several years of trained he deemed Jaicen ready for Padawan-hood and send Jaicen to the Jedi temple to train his skills further and to aid the Jedi. Jaicen still has a close bond with him and they converse from time to time.
Since Jaicen is confined to a wheelchair a battledroid he created himself, and called TG-100, performs most of the physical work for him, Jaicen also gave his training lightsaber to the droid, since he is better at protecting him than Jaicen himself is. In between Missions Jaicen can be found on the Jedi temple accompanied by several droids, Usually TG-100, a Medical droid and an Astromech droid.
His force skills are Control Machine and Mind Tricks. His skills are mostly droid repair and programming. Furthermore his droid has Jaicens lightsaber skill transferred through the force.
His attitude is somewhat fatalistic and patient and his view is on the world is 'gray'. You can use whatever you want to use, just don't use it for evil. He likes to play the part of a normal non-force sensitive human and if people want to see him as a helpless disabled in a wheelchair: sure, whatever.

● Power: Through meditation, you can connect to a complex machine provided that machine has a DEM-Crystal. You can attune to a single machine.
● Rank 1: You can give basic commands such as movement, carrying, or pressing elevator buttons to the machine with which you are connected by means of the Force. This power works only on short range (approximately ten meters).
●● Rank 2: The speed and accuracy of your control over the machine increases to a point where it can aid you in combat. For purposes of combat, you and the machine are counted as a single entity, using your stats (and not the machine's stats). This allows you to have more options for Direct Combat Actions and Advantage Actions, for example. This power works only on personal range (no more than one bodylength away from you).
● Power: The Jedi can use the Force to make another believe a simple lie and even guide their actions, provided the action is not too far out of character. A guard might be mind tricked to let someone pass at a general checkpoint, but they could not be mind tricked to swallow a live grenade, for example. The action must be immediate.
● Rank 1: The Jedi can make a subject forget they ever saw the Jedi. If the Jedi did something important in their presence, they remember someone doing it, but they do not remember it was the Jedi. Using this power requires an opposed check. You can use this power a number of times per day equal to the number of ranks in this force power.
